element threejs main vue

[Vue warn]: <transition-group> children must be keyed: <ElTag>

记录今天遇到的bug 解决方法,一个网友说的是 我试了,不行,然后在他的评论里面看到一个人回复的 这个是可以的,我用了很多v-if和v-else,所以加了key就解决了问题,下面是我加的 ......

vue实现文件的分片上传

const CHUNK_SIZE = 100 * 1024; // 100KBfunction sliceFile(file) { const totalChunks = Math.ceil(file.size / CHUNK_SIZE); const chunks = []; for (let i ......
文件 vue

Vue实验记录

webpack安装 首先下载node.js https://nodejs.org/en 下载完成后进行安装,直接下一步就可以 安装完成后,在cmd中查看是否安装成功 然后安装webpack 安装脚手架 创建项目 选择第二个 创建完成后的效果 进入项目并运行 在学习通中下载源码,把源码按照项目格式放到 ......
Vue

element-ui 标签tabs el-tabs浏览器会卡死,其他都正常。

1、需要卸载旧版本: npm uninstall element-ui -S 2、安装指定版本: npm i element-ui@2.6.3 -S 【网上看到2.6.3可以,最新版本也不好使】 3、重新npm install 搞定。标签tabs页面出来了 来源: https://blog.csdn ......
tabs element-ui 浏览器 element el-tabs

vue中文件上传方法

1.单文件上传 <template> <div> <label for="fileInput"> <i aria-hidden="true" class="cursor">上传文件</i> </label> <input v-show="false" type="file" id="fileInpu ......
文件 方法 vue

Vue-cli 用自定义的组件有遇到过哪些问题?

在 components 目录新建你的组件文件(indexPage.vue), script 一定要 export default {} 在需要用的页面(组件)中导入:import indexPage from '@/components/indexPage.vue' 注入到 vue 的子组件的co ......
组件 Vue-cli 问题 Vue cli

element-ui tree 异步树实现勾选自动展开、指定展开、指定勾选

element-ui tree 异步树实现勾选自动展开、指定展开、指定勾选 背景 项目中用到了vue的element-ui框架,用到了el-tree组件。由于数据量很大,使用了数据懒加载模式,即异步树。异步树采用复选框进行结点选择的时候,没法自动展开,官方文档找了半天也没有找到好的办法! 找不到相关 ......
element-ui element tree ui

element中的el-select下拉框多选显示的tags文本内容过长导致显示溢出框外

/* select多选tags超出省略显示 */ .el-select__tags-text { display: inline-block; max-width: 60px; overflow: hidden; text-overflow: ellipsis; white-space: nowra ......
el-select 文本 element 内容 select

Vue3+Element plus 实现表格可编辑

<template> <div> <el-button type="primary" @click="handleAdd"> 新增 </el-button> </div> <div> <el-table :data="tableData" style="width: 100%" border @ce ......
表格 Element Vue3 plus Vue

vue3 与 vue2 的区别

布尔型 Attribute​ 布尔型 attribute 依据 true / false 值来决定 attribute 是否应该存在于该元素上。disabled 就是最常见的例子之一。 v-bind 在这种场景下的行为略有不同: <button :disabled="isButtonDisabled ......
vue vue3 vue2

Vue3使用wangEditor文本

1、安装wangEditor npm install @wangeditor/editor --savenpm install @wangeditor/editor-for-vue@next --save 2、代码 <template> <el-dialog v-model="state.dialo ......
wangEditor 文本 Vue3 Vue

Vue_MQTT项目搭建记录

新建vue3项目 # 新建 vite + vue3的项目 npm init vue@latest yarn 安装依赖包 yarn add mqtt 初探 - 连接阿里云物联网平台 代码: <template> <div> <h1>LED - IOT</h1> <button @click="conn ......
Vue_MQTT 项目 MQTT Vue

vue3源码学习api-vue-sfc文件编译

vue 最有代表性质的就是.VUE 的文件,每一个vue文件都是一个组件,那么vue 组件的编译过程是什么样的呢 Vue 单文件组件 (SFC)和指令 ast 语法树 一个 Vue 单文件组件 (SFC),通常使用 *.vue 作为文件扩展名,它是一种使用了类似 HTML 语法的自定义文件格式,用于 ......
api-vue-sfc vue 源码 文件 vue3

基于element-ui开发组件自行制作的翻页小组件

表格展示区 <el-table :data="dis" style="width: 100%;height: 525px;"> </el-table> 翻页区 <to-page :value="{ page : tableData.length, current_page:current_page ......
组件 element-ui element ui

vue脚手架的data与props

1.共同之处: data与props都是数据,都可以存储,并且动态渲染 2.不同之处: data是组件本身的数据,支持自身修改,然而props是外部数据(由父组件传递而来的数据),不支持自身修改,如果想要修改需要this.$emit('父组件监视函数名',希望修改的的值的结果) ......
脚手架 props data vue

Vue 组件里的定时器要怎么销毁?

如果页面上有很多定时器,可以在 data 选项中创建一个对象 timer,给每个定时器取个名字一一映射在对象 timer 中, 在 beforeDestroy 构造函数中清除, beforeDestroy(){ for(let k in this.timer){ clearInterval(k) } ......
定时器 组件 Vue

记录--Vue2屎山之 Table 屎山

这里给大家分享我在网上总结出来的一些知识,希望对大家有所帮助 前言 Vue2 将在 2023 年年底停止维护了,但是 Vue2 的代码却不会在 2023 年消失,还会越来越多;难以想象几十万行或者几百万行的 Vue2 代码迁移到 Vue3,这是不可能办到的; 老一点的前端程序员肯定经历过把大型项目从 ......
Table Vue2 Vue

vue3 甘特图(四):甘特图进度条拆分

vue3 甘特图(四):甘特图进度条拆分 目前项目采取有两种拆分进度条的方式。单个进度条展示多维度数据,一个总任务条下有多个子进程展示。 1.1 单个进度条展示多维度数据(不关联时间),如图 此方法是通过设置单个进度条上内容,以一个进度条为容器,修改内容(即task_text内容)展示多维度的数据, ......
进度 vue3 vue

vue 甘特图(附件):甘特图附件

甘特图样式: .gantt_container { border-color: transparent !important; .gantt_right { top: 0% !important; display: flex !important; } .gantt_side_content { o ......
附件 vue

VUE 前端读取excel表格内容

<el-upload class="upload-demo" :action="''" :show-file-list="false" :auto-upload="false" :before-upload="beforeUpload" :on-success="handleSuccess" :on ......
前端 表格 内容 excel VUE

vue3 AntV-X6 引入插件报错

vue3 AntV-X6 引入插件报错: Uncaught TypeError: Cannot read properties of undefined (reading 'ToolItem') vite 引入路径的问题解决就是在引入插件的路径后面加上/lib: import { Keyboard ......
插件 AntV-X vue3 AntV vue

vue基于vue-pdf实现pdf预览

<template> <div class="pdf-container"> <div class="page-tool"> 文件名称扩展 <div class="page-tool-fixed" v-if="showTool"> <span class="scale-icon" @click="p ......
vue pdf vue-pdf

如何实现元素的平滑上升?(vue和react版)

首先我们看下我们有时候需要在官网或者列表中给元素添加一个动画使元素能够平滑的出现在我们的视野中。 如上图所示,我们在vue中可以自定义指令,当我们需要的时候可以直接使用。废话不多说直接上代码。 首先我们创建一个vSlideIn.ts文件 import { DirectiveBinding } fro ......
元素 react vue

Vue3调用Element-plus涉及子组件v-model双向绑定props问题

Vue3调用Element-plus涉及子组件v-model双向绑定props问题 在Vue3调用Element-plus的el-dialog组件时,碰到个很有意思的问题,el-dialog的属性值v-model直接控制对话框的显示与否,点击关闭对话框和遮罩区域,组件内部会自动更改v-model的值 ......
双向 Element-plus 组件 Element v-model

在vue项目开发过程中,输入框以表单形式提交后,路径中多了问号?

结果是:http://localhost:8100/#/ 改变为 http://localhost:8100/?#/ 导致路由跳转出现问题。 原因:这里是 form 表单,点击了button 按钮,触发了他的默认事件,就是触发了提交这个行为。 解决方案:使用@click.prevent 阻止默认事件 ......
项目开发 表单 问号 路径 形式

SDL2 无法解析的外部符号 main,函数 "int __cdecl invoke_main(void)" (?invoke_main@@YAHXZ)

一、概述 在使用VisualStudio+CMake集成SDL2的过程中。运行一个Demo示例出现了以下错误提示 无法解析的外部符号 main,函数 "int __cdecl invoke_main(void)" (?invoke_main@@YAHXZ) 二、解决办法 上面问题的主要原因是程序找不 ......
invoke_main main invoke quot 函数

element使用组件el-form自动定位到未填写的必填条目

问题:在form表单el-form中经常会出现表单条目比较多的问题,而且在提交的时候需要校验表单并且定位到相应的条目位置。 解决: html: <el-form ref="form" :model="form" :rules="rules" label-width="140px"> <el-form ......
条目 组件 element el-form form

怎么捕获 Vue 组件的错误?

errorCaptured 是组件内部钩子函数,当捕获一个来自子孙组件的错误时被调用,接收 error、vm、info 三个参数,return false 后可以阻止错误继续向上抛出 errorHandler 为全局钩子函数,使用 Vue.config.errorHandler 配置,接收参数与 e ......
组件 错误 Vue

Vue3实现图片滚轮缩放和拖拽

在项目开发中遇到一个需求: 1:用鼠标滚轮可对图片进行缩放处理 2:点击按钮可对图片进行缩放处理 3:可对图片进行拖拽处理 我在开发中通过自己实现与百度查看优秀的铁子进行了两种类型的使用 <template> <div ref="imgWrap" class="wrap" @mousewheel.p ......
滚轮 图片 Vue3 Vue

Vite4+Typescript+Vue3+Pinia 从零搭建(3) - vite配置

项目代码同步至码云 weiz-vue3-template 关于vite的详细配置可查看 vite官方文档,本文简单介绍vite的常用配置。 初始内容 项目初建后,vite.config.ts 的默认内容如下: import { defineConfig } from 'vite' import vu ......
Typescript Vite4 Pinia Vite Vue3